Lamium amplexicaule L. |
|
|
Lamium amplexicaule, a dicot, is an annual herb that is not native to California; it was introduced from elsewhere and naturalized in the wild. |
|
| Common names: |
Giraffe's Head, Henbit, dead nettle, giraffe head, henbit deadnettle
|
|
Communities: |
introduced plant which is becoming naturalized, weed, species characteristic of disturbed places |
|
Habitat: |
disturbed [Walker] |
|
Family: Lamiaceae |
